柴达木石——一种锌和铁的硫酸盐新矿物   总被引:1,自引:0,他引:1  
柴达木石是一种Zn和Fe~(3+)的硫酸盐新矿物,发现于我国青海省柴达木锡铁山铅锌矿氧化带。矿物属单斜晶系,空间群P2_1/m或P2_1,晶胞参数a=9.759(9)A,b=7.134(9)A,c=7.335(11)A,β=106.2(1)°,Z=2。化学分子式为ZnFe~(3+)(SO_4)_2(OH)·4H_2O。它是四水铜铁矾(guildite)的类似物。  相似文献

彭志忠石产于湖南安化白钨矿区,是一种富含镁、锡、铝的复杂氧化物。矿物为浅黄褐色、浅黄色,少量无色,晶体呈六方板状。晶体化学式为:(Mg,Zn,Fe,Al)_4(Sn,Fe)_2(Al,□)_(10)O_(22)(OH)_2,空间群P_3ml,a=5.692(5)A,c=13.78(2)A,V=386.7A~3,Z=1。D=4.22(3)g/cm~3,H≥8,一轴正晶,ω=1.802(2),ε=1.814(2)。  相似文献

The crystal structure of lisiguangite,CuPtBiS3,from Yanshan mountains,Chengde Prefecture,Hebei Province,China has been determined by single crystal X-ray diffraction.It belongs to orthorhombic space group P2_12_12_1 with a = 7.7372(15) A,b = 12.844(3) A,c = 4.9062(10) A,V =487.57(17) A~3,Z = 4.The final full-matric least-square refinement on F2 converged with Rl = 0.0495 and wR2 = 0.0992 for 704 observed reflections[I≥2σ(I)].Lisiguangite is the isomorph of known CuNiSbS_3 and CuNiBiS_3· Pt~(2+) and Bi~(3+) have the distorted octahedral coordination enviroments composed of two metal and four S and Cu~(+2) has a distorted tetrahedral coordination environment with four S atoms.Each S atom is surrounded by four metals to give a tetrahedral environment.The crystal structure is a complex 3 dimensional network.  相似文献

本文利用直接法和富利叶合成侧定了产于我国四川省三叠系蒸发岩里的多钙钾石膏 的晶体结构,结构参数经最小二乘法修正后,,R = 0.084。结构分析表明,多钙钾石膏属单斜晶系,空间群C2/c, a = 17.462 (8)A,b=6.828(2)A,c=18.219(9)A,β=113.45(4)º。,V=1992(1)A3, Z=4, Dm=2,91, Dx=2.90(3)。三个硫酸根四面体各自的平均S-O键长为1,467、 1.464 和1.478A。有三套Ca原子,其中Ca1在二次对称轴上。Ca原子的配位数为9,各自的平均Ca-O键 长为2.516、 2,515和2.459A。K原子的配位数为8。首次测定了矿一物中氢原子的位置,证实矿物含1个结晶水,而不是含1.5个结晶水。晶体化学式为K2Ca5 (SO4)6.H2O。  相似文献

钴硅锌矿是一种具有特征深蓝紫色、油脂光泽和玻璃光泽的钴锌硅酸盐矿物,属三方晶系。空间群:C_(3j)~2—R3、a=13.9559A,c=9.3364A,c/a=0.6690,V=1574.8104A~3,Z=18。该矿物理论式为(Zn,Co)_2SiO_4,实验式为:(Zn_(1.26),Co_(O.74))SiO_4。据红外光谱以及X射线粉晶分析,其结构与硅锌矿(Zn_2SiO_4)类似。  相似文献

在分析3CaO·3Al2O3·CaSO4(C4A3S)生成反应热力学参数的基础上,结合变温XRD实验,研究C4A3S在静态空气、流动O2和流动Ar条件下生成的动力学过程,并探讨气氛对C4A2S生成的影响.静态空气下,C4A3S生成反应表观活化能Ea=228 kJ/mol;流通O2气氛下,Ea=68 kJ/mol;流通Ar气氛下,Ea=254kJ/mol.O2气氛能有效地降低C4A3S生成反应表观活化能,惰性(Ar)的贫氧气氛不利于C4A3S生成.  相似文献

一种硼酸盐的新矿物—袁复礼石   总被引:3,自引:0,他引:3  
袁复礼石是一种Mg、Fe2+、Al和Ti的硼酸盐新矿物,发现于辽宁省宽甸县砖庙硼矿区。该矿物黑色,近不透明,金刚光泽-半金属光泽。反射色亮灰,内反射深红褐色。非均质性弱,偏光色红褐。晶体呈细柱状,O.1×0.2×l mm。晶体化学式为:(Mg0.91Fe2+0.09)(Fe3+0.56Al3+0.19 Mg0.17Ti0.11Fe2+0.10)1.13(B0.92O3.00)O。空间群Pnam, a=9.258(6)A,b=9.351(4)A, c=3.081(2)A,V=266.80(2)A,Z=4。 D=3.80 g/cm3, H=5-6,VHN50=843 kg/mm2,{100}解理完全。红外光谱吸收谱带为:1387, 1210, 1024, 951, 733, 600, 510和408 cm-1。穆斯堡尔谱证明,以三价铁为主,二价铁较少。Fe3+占据M(1)晶位,Fe2+占据M(1)和M(2)晶位。袁复礼石为硼钛镁石的富Fe3+类似物。  相似文献

多钙钾石膏产于四川省渠县农乐地区中-下三叠统的杂卤石矿层里,与硬石膏一起交。代杂卤石。矿物呈板状,{110}解理中等。比重2.91。折光率:Ng=1.585,Nm=1.5θ8,NP=1.560。二轴晶正,2V=79°。该矿物属单斜晶系。空间群C2/c。晶胞参数:a_0=17.479A,b_0=6.821A,C_0=18.218A,β=113.39°。粉末图的五条强衍射线为:3.01(10)、3.16(8)、3.38(6)、2.83(4)、2.74(3)。根据化学分析计算,其化学式为:K_2SO_4·5CaSO_4·H_2O。结晶水含量2.O4%。文内列出了该矿物的差热(DTA)和热失重(TGA)、红外吸收光谱等新资料。  相似文献

以作用形式较为简单的双排悬臂抗滑桩(未带连梁)为模型并基于结构力学位移法得出的双排桩滑坡推力传递分配计算公式为基础,结合推力较大的红石包滑坡作为工程实例,分别分析了双排桩静排距,前后排桩的截面尺寸和桩间土弹性模量对推力传递分配的影响,得出了以下结论:(1)当增大后排桩的刚度或减小前排桩的刚度时,桩土相互挤压作用越小, A2/A1随之减小,反之A2/A1增大。(2)增大排距b时,A1减小,A2在b=3~10m时逐渐减小,但是变化幅度不大; 在b=10~21m时,不断增大。(3)当增大桩间土弹性模量时,A2增大。(4)随着前排桩截面高度的增大,A1、A2逐渐增大; 随着后排桩截面高度的增大,A1、A2逐渐减小。  相似文献

在白云鄂博地区发现的水磷钙钍石呈脉状产于元古代变质石英砂岩中,共生矿物有透辉石、金红石、磷灰石、重晶石、赤铁矿和黄铁矿等。颜色从浅黄色到红褐色乃至黑色,从透明至半透明以至不透明。红褐色水磷钙钍石为玻璃光泽,比重3.42,摩氏硬度4.28—4.29,磁化率(2.34—3.99)×10~(-6)C·G·S·m cm~3/g,平均折光率No=1.65,Ne=1,66,一轴晶(+)。 水磷钙钍石的化学式为:(Ca_(0.5751)Th_(0.4502)U_(0.0070)La_(0.0030))_(1.0353)(P_(0.7578)S_(0.0928))_(0.8506)O_4(CO_3)_(0.1603),0.9H_2O。六方晶系,晶胞参数a=6.94A,c=6.51A。  相似文献

Pant-y-ffynnon Quarry in South Wales yielded a rich cache of fossils in the early 1950s, including articulated specimens of new species (the small sauropodomorph dinosaur Pantydraco caducus and the crocodylomorph Terrestrisuchus gracilis), but no substantial study of the wider fauna of the Pant-y-ffynnon fissure systems has been published. Here, our overview of existing specimens, a few described but mostly undescribed, as well as freshly processed material, provides a comprehensive picture of the Pant-y-ffynnon palaeo-island of the Late Triassic. This was an island with a relatively impoverished fauna dominated by small clevosaurs (rhynchocephalians), including a new species, Clevosaurus cambrica, described here from a partially articulated specimen and isolated bones. The new species has a dental morphology that is intermediate between the Late Triassic Clevosaurus hudsoni, from Cromhall Quarry to the east, and the younger C. convallis from Pant Quarry to the west, suggesting adaptive radiation of clevosaurs in the palaeo-archipelago. The larger reptiles on the palaeo-island do not exceed 1.5?m in length, including a small carnivorous crocodylomorph, Terrestrisuchus, and a possible example of insular dwarfism in the basal dinosaur Pantydraco.  相似文献

The solubilities of columbite, tantalite, wolframite, rutile, zircon and hafnon were determined as a function of the water contents in peralkaline and subaluminous granite melts. All experiments were conducted at 1035 °C and 2 kbar and the water contents of the melts ranged from nominally dry to approximately 6 wt.% H2O. Accessory phase solubilities are not affected by the water content of the peralkaline melt. By contrast, solubilities are affected by the water content of the subaluminous melt, where the solubilities of all the accessory phases examined increase with the water content of the melt, up to 2 wt.% H2O. At higher water contents, solubilities are nearly constant. It can be concluded that water is not an important control of accessory phase solubility, although the water content will affect diffusivities of components in the melt, thus whether or not accessory phases will be present as restite material. The solubility behaviour in the subaluminous and peralkaline melts supports previous spectroscopic studies, which have observed differences in the coordination of high field strength elements in dry vs. wet subaluminous granitic glasses, but not for peralkaline granitic glasses. Lastly, the fact that wolframite solubility increases with increasing water content in the subaluminous melt suggests that tungsten dissolved as a hexavalent species.  相似文献

Calcite samples were extracted both from the rock matrix and the superficial coating of a karstified fault plane of an underground quarry, located in the eastern border of the Paris basin. The karstification is dated as Quaternary. Analysis of mechanical calcite twinning reveals that only the calcite matrix has also undergone a compression trending WNW that can be attributed to the Mio-Pliocene alpine collision. Both coating and matrix have undergone a strike-slip regime with σ1 roughly trending north–south, that could correspond to the regional present-day state of stress, a strike-slip compression rather trending NNW, modified by local phenomena.
